Traditional light diffusing agents often include inorganic powders like titanium dioxide or silica. While effective to a degree, they can sometimes lead to opacity issues, reduced light transmittance, or problems with dispersion in certain polymer systems. In contrast, our silicone resin micro spheres are characterized by their uniform, spherical morphology and specific particle size distributions. This consistent structure is key to their superior performance in scattering light, providing a softer, more aesthetically pleasing diffusion effect without sacrificing overall brightness. The precise refractive index difference between the silicone spheres and the host material is carefully managed to optimize light diffusion.

Another common alternative is organic polymer microspheres. However, these may not always offer the same level of heat resistance or chemical stability as silicone-based materials. Our silicone resin micro spheres, with their inherent silicon-oxygen backbone, boast exceptional thermal stability, tolerating temperatures well above 400°C. This makes them ideal for high-temperature processing applications, such as plastic extrusion, where lower-melting point alternatives might degrade or alter their properties.

The manufacturing process for our silicone resin micro spheres, often involving controlled hydrolysis and polymerization of organosilicone precursors, results in a high-purity product with minimal impurities. This purity is crucial for applications where color stability and absence of defects are paramount, such as in high-end LED lighting or sensitive cosmetic formulations.
